Preferred Label : Mediator Complex Component Gene;

NCIt definition : Regulation of mRNA synthesis requires intermediary proteins that transduce regulatory signals from upstream transcriptional activator proteins to basal transcription machinery at the core promoter. Mediator Complex Component Genes encode the mediator complex, one type of intermediary and which consists of approximately 20 polypeptides. It is physically associated with RNA polymerase II and is essential for transcriptional activation. (from OMIM 602984);
